Home
last modified time | relevance | path

Searched refs:volume_group_t (Results 1 – 25 of 28) sorted by relevance

12

/frameworks/av/services/audiopolicy/engine/common/include/
DProductStrategy.h45 volume_group_t mVolumeGroup = VOLUME_GROUP_NONE;
92 volume_group_t getVolumeGroupForAttributes(const audio_attributes_t &attr) const;
94 volume_group_t getVolumeGroupForStreamType(audio_stream_type_t stream) const;
96 volume_group_t getDefaultVolumeGroup() const;
153 volume_group_t getVolumeGroupForAttributes(const audio_attributes_t &attr) const;
155 volume_group_t getVolumeGroupForStreamType(audio_stream_type_t stream) const;
157 volume_group_t getDefaultVolumeGroup() const;
DVolumeGroup.h35 volume_group_t getId() const { return mId; } in getId()
51 const volume_group_t mId;
55 class VolumeGroupMap : public std::map<volume_group_t, sp<VolumeGroup> >
DEngineBase.h74 IVolumeCurves *getVolumeCurvesForVolumeGroup(volume_group_t group) const override in getVolumeCurvesForVolumeGroup()
82 volume_group_t getVolumeGroupForAttributes(const audio_attributes_t &attr) const override;
84 volume_group_t getVolumeGroupForStreamType(audio_stream_type_t stream) const override;
/frameworks/av/media/libaudioclient/include/media/
DAudioAttributes.h32 AudioAttributes(volume_group_t groupId, in AudioAttributes()
43 volume_group_t getGroupId() const { return mGroupId; } in getGroupId()
57 volume_group_t mGroupId = VOLUME_GROUP_NONE;
DAudioCommonTypes.h42 enum volume_group_t : uint32_t;
43 static const volume_group_t VOLUME_GROUP_NONE = static_cast<volume_group_t>(-1);
DAudioVolumeGroup.h32 volume_group_t group, in AudioVolumeGroup()
38 volume_group_t getId() const { return mGroupId; } in getId()
47 volume_group_t mGroupId = VOLUME_GROUP_NONE;
DIAudioPolicyServiceClient.h52 virtual void onAudioVolumeGroupChanged(volume_group_t group, int flags) = 0;
DAudioSystem.h397 volume_group_t &volumeGroup);
427 virtual void onAudioVolumeGroupChanged(volume_group_t group, int flags) = 0;
541 virtual void onAudioVolumeGroupChanged(volume_group_t group, int flags);
DIAudioPolicyService.h224 volume_group_t &volumeGroup) = 0;
/frameworks/av/services/audiopolicy/engine/common/src/
DProductStrategy.cpp123 volume_group_t ProductStrategy::getVolumeGroupForAttributes(const audio_attributes_t &attr) const in getVolumeGroupForAttributes()
133 volume_group_t ProductStrategy::getVolumeGroupForStreamType(audio_stream_type_t stream) const in getVolumeGroupForStreamType()
143 volume_group_t ProductStrategy::getDefaultVolumeGroup() const in getDefaultVolumeGroup()
275 volume_group_t ProductStrategyMap::getVolumeGroupForAttributes(const audio_attributes_t &attr) const in getVolumeGroupForAttributes()
278 volume_group_t group = iter.second->getVolumeGroupForAttributes(attr); in getVolumeGroupForAttributes()
286 volume_group_t ProductStrategyMap::getVolumeGroupForStreamType(audio_stream_type_t stream) const in getVolumeGroupForStreamType()
289 volume_group_t group = iter.second->getVolumeGroupForStreamType(stream); in getVolumeGroupForStreamType()
298 volume_group_t ProductStrategyMap::getDefaultVolumeGroup() const in getDefaultVolumeGroup()
DEngineBase.cpp280 volume_group_t volGr = mProductStrategies.getVolumeGroupForAttributes(attr); in getVolumeCurvesForAttributes()
288 volume_group_t volGr = mProductStrategies.getVolumeGroupForStreamType(stream); in getVolumeCurvesForStreamType()
324 volume_group_t EngineBase::getVolumeGroupForAttributes(const audio_attributes_t &attr) const in getVolumeGroupForAttributes()
329 volume_group_t EngineBase::getVolumeGroupForStreamType(audio_stream_type_t stream) const in getVolumeGroupForStreamType()
DVolumeGroup.cpp35 mName(name), mId(static_cast<volume_group_t>(HandleGenerator<uint32_t>::getNextHandle())), in VolumeGroup()
/frameworks/av/services/audiopolicy/engine/interface/
DEngineInterface.h36 using VolumeGroupVector = std::vector<volume_group_t>;
260 virtual IVolumeCurves *getVolumeCurvesForVolumeGroup(volume_group_t group) const = 0;
275 virtual volume_group_t getVolumeGroupForAttributes(const audio_attributes_t &attr) const = 0;
284 virtual volume_group_t getVolumeGroupForStreamType(audio_stream_type_t stream) const = 0;
/frameworks/av/media/libaudioclient/
DIAudioPolicyServiceClient.cpp114 void onAudioVolumeGroupChanged(volume_group_t group, int flags) in onAudioVolumeGroupChanged()
174 volume_group_t group = static_cast<volume_group_t>(data.readUint32()); in onTransact()
DAudioAttributes.cpp46 mGroupId = static_cast<volume_group_t>(parcel->readUint32()); in readFromParcel()
DAudioVolumeGroup.cpp35 mGroupId = static_cast<volume_group_t>(parcel->readInt32()); in readFromParcel()
/frameworks/base/core/jni/
Dandroid_media_AudioVolumeGroupCallback.h34 void onAudioVolumeGroupChanged(volume_group_t group, int flags) override;
Dandroid_media_AudioVolumeGroupCallback.cpp71 void JNIAudioVolumeGroupCallback::onAudioVolumeGroupChanged(volume_group_t group, int flags) in onAudioVolumeGroupChanged()
/frameworks/av/services/audiopolicy/service/
DAudioPolicyService.h268 volume_group_t &volumeGroup);
309 void onAudioVolumeGroupChanged(volume_group_t group, int flags);
310 void doOnAudioVolumeGroupChanged(volume_group_t group, int flags);
484 void changeAudioVolumeGroupCommand(volume_group_t group, int flags);
572 volume_group_t mGroup;
718 virtual void onAudioVolumeGroupChanged(volume_group_t group, int flags);
738 void onAudioVolumeGroupChanged(volume_group_t group, int flags);
DAudioPolicyClientImpl.cpp231 void AudioPolicyService::AudioPolicyClient::onAudioVolumeGroupChanged(volume_group_t group, in onAudioVolumeGroupChanged()
DAudioPolicyService.cpp216 void AudioPolicyService::onAudioVolumeGroupChanged(volume_group_t group, int flags) in onAudioVolumeGroupChanged()
221 void AudioPolicyService::doOnAudioVolumeGroupChanged(volume_group_t group, int flags) in doOnAudioVolumeGroupChanged()
330 void AudioPolicyService::NotificationClient::onAudioVolumeGroupChanged(volume_group_t group, in onAudioVolumeGroupChanged()
1513 void AudioPolicyService::AudioCommandThread::changeAudioVolumeGroupCommand(volume_group_t group, in changeAudioVolumeGroupCommand()
/frameworks/av/services/audiopolicy/common/include/
DVolume.h35 enum VolumeSource : std::underlying_type<volume_group_t>::type;
/frameworks/av/services/audiopolicy/tests/
DAudioPolicyTestClient.h75 void onAudioVolumeGroupChanged(volume_group_t /*group*/, int /*flags*/) override { } in onAudioVolumeGroupChanged() argument
/frameworks/av/services/audiopolicy/managerdefault/
DAudioPolicyManager.h312 volume_group_t &volumeGroup) in getVolumeGroupFromAudioAttributes()
372 std::vector<volume_group_t> getVolumeGroups() const in getVolumeGroups()
377 VolumeSource toVolumeSource(volume_group_t volumeGroup) const in toVolumeSource()
392 static_cast<volume_group_t>(volumeSource)); in getVolumeCurves()
/frameworks/av/services/audiopolicy/
DAudioPolicyInterface.h277 volume_group_t &volumeGroup) = 0;
385 virtual void onAudioVolumeGroupChanged(volume_group_t group, int flags) = 0;

12